    So for me the goalkeeper one is tricky. We never actually had a proper great goalkeeper this time in the prem. Both Forster and Boruc were backed up by fantastic defenders. Forster was never the same after that Vassell goal away to Villa where he came out and got done. Boric had moments of absolute madness. I would slightly edge towards Boruc as he could save in the corners. RB is Clyne. Definitely got the best years out of him. CB pairing of Toby and VVD LB Bertrand. Shout out to Shaw, I think he's a 100% passion player.
    I'm going with big Vic and Morgan. Then it's the guy we never replaced, the creator Tadic just in front, Mane left. Lallana right and the unit Pelle up top.
